    Quote Originally Posted by makar1 View Post
    Aren't open backs more suitable for studio monitoring? Assuming you're not in a noisy environment.
    Open headphones (monaural/binaural) are nicest for longer studio sessions. Your ears will fatigue more easily with closed headphones.
    If I were to choose between the AKG H242HD, the Sennheiser 25, the BeyerDynamic DT-770/DT-880/DT-990, it would be the BeyerDynamic DT-990 or AKG K242HD because of them being open headphones. (DT-880 close third because they are semi-open if I am correct)

    Not to say anything about the soundquality of the DT-990 being better, if anything, I think the Sennheiser will score as well as the DT-990.
    The only two gripes I have with the sennheisers is the tight squeeze fit and them being closed cans.

    My head's too big so I'll end up with a headache within 5 minutes of listening through them because of that tight fit.

    I tried using my HDJ2000s as studio headset a few times, but they boost too hard in the mid range frequencies, so they're not suitable.

    The reason I got the DT-880 over the more expensive DT-990 is the more natural frequency response, which is what you want for production.

    The top of the tree for me would be the Sennheiser HD-800, but they're very expensive!
